To date, TreEnt's consultancy work in the local government sector either directly or on a sub-consultancy basis has included the following:

  • 2011: assisting with the preparation of a special rate variation application on behalf of the Woollahra Municipal Council (through Review Today) 
  • 2010: a report analysing the finances of Bega Valley Shire Council, for Review Today
  • 2009: a report analysing the asset management and financial sustainability of Darwin City Council (through Access Economics)
  • 2009: a report analysing the finances of Dubbo City Council, for Review Today
  • 2009: a report analysing the finances of Armidale-Dumaresq Council, for Review Today
  • 2009: the updating of various councils’ financial sustainability assessments, for the WA Local Government Association (through Access Economics)
  • 2009: a report quantifying the fiscal stimulus effects of local government infrastructure spending, for the SA Local Government Association (through Access Economics)  
  • 2008: a report exploring the impact of the global financial crisis on local government, for the SA Local Government Association (through Access Economics)
  • 2008: a report analysing the finances of Greater Taree City Council, for Review Today
  • 2008: two reports analysing aspects of a Productivity Commission draft research report assessing local government revenue raising capacity, for the SA Local Government Association (through Access Economics)
  • 2007: a report analysing the finances of Great Lakes Council, for Review Today (through Access Economics)
  • 2007: a report analysing the finances of Albury City Council, for Review Today (through Access Economics)
  • 2007: a report analysing the finances of Wollongong City Council, for Review Today (through Access Economics)
  • 2007: a report reviewing the finances of local government in Tasmania, for the Local Government Association of Tasmania (through Access Economics)
  • 2006: a report analysing the finances of Newcastle City Council, for Review Today (through Access Economics)
  • 2006: a report reviewing the finances of local government in Western Australia, for the Systemic Sustainability Study Panel (through Access Economics)
  • 2006: drafting chapter 11 "Local Government Finance" of the report of the Independent Inquiry into the Financial Sustainability of NSW Local Government, for the Independent Review Panel
  • 2006: a report forecasting the council’s long-term financial outlook, for the City of Charles Sturt (through Access Economics)
  • 2005: a report reviewing the finances of local government in New South Wales, for the Independent Review Panel (through Access Economics)
  • 2005: a report reviewing the finances of local government in South Australia, for the SA Local Government Association (through Access Economics)
  • 2004: a report assessing certain reform proposals in relation to local government financing, for the Australian CEOs Group (through Access Economics)
  • 2003: a report entitled “The Case for Increased Funding for Local Government" prepared for the City of Port Phillip (through Access Economics)
  • 2002: a report examining vertical fiscal imbalance issues at the local sector level in Australia and options for local government financial assistance grants, for the Australian Local Government Association (through Access Economics)
